Yes, the Minoans imported various goods, including oil, wine, jewelry, and crafts. They had a thriving trade network that connected them with other cultures across the Mediterranean, allowing them to acquire luxury items and raw materials. This exchange played a significant role in their economy and cultural development. The Minoans also exported their own products, such as pottery and textiles, in return.
